How Does Draw Weight Impact Performance?

The draw weight of a compound bow significantly affects its performance, influencing factors such as arrow speed, accuracy, and the archer’s ability to handle the bow.

  • Arrow Speed: Higher draw weights generally result in faster arrow speeds, which can enhance penetration and improve long-range accuracy. When an archer pulls back on the string, a heavier draw weight stores more energy, which is then transferred to the arrow upon release.
  • Accuracy: The consistency of draw weight contributes to overall accuracy. A well-balanced draw weight allows for steadier aiming and less fatigue, leading to more precise shots, especially over extended periods of use.
  • Physical Demand: The draw weight impacts how physically demanding it is to shoot the bow. Archers with less upper body strength may struggle with higher draw weights, making it crucial for them to choose a bow that matches their physical capabilities to maintain shooting comfort and consistency.
  • Bow Performance: Different bows are designed to perform optimally at specific draw weights. The best American-made compound bows are often engineered to maximize efficiency and power at their intended draw weights, ensuring that archers get the best performance tailored to their needs.
  • Customization Options: Many compound bows offer adjustable draw weights, allowing archers to customize their setup for different situations, from target shooting to hunting. This flexibility enables users to find a balance that works for their specific shooting style and physical abilities.

Why is Axle-to-Axle Length Important in Compound Bows?

When selecting a compound bow, the axle-to-axle length is a crucial factor that significantly impacts performance and handling. This measurement, taken from one axle of the cam to the other, influences several key aspects of bow performance:

  • Stability: Longer axle-to-axle lengths generally enhance stability. A bow with longer limbs can mitigate torque during release, leading to improved accuracy and more consistent shot placement.

  • Maneuverability: Shorter bows are easier to maneuver in treestands or tight hunting spots. They offer greater agility, making them suitable for dynamic shooting situations.

  • Draw Length and Comfort: The axle-to-axle length also plays a role in accommodating various draw lengths. A well-matched setup between the bow’s length and the shooter’s draw length ensures a more comfortable shooting experience.

  • Target Types: Different lengths cater to various shooting styles. Target archers may prefer longer bows for stability, while hunters might opt for the compactness of shorter models for mobility.

Understanding how axle-to-axle length affects these elements helps in selecting the best American-made compound bow that meets specific needs and preferences.

Which Brands Are Best Known for American Made Compound Bows?

Some of the most reputable brands known for American-made compound bows include:

  • Mathews: Renowned for their innovative designs and precision engineering, Mathews bows are crafted in Sparta, Wisconsin. They are popular among both amateur and professional archers for their smooth draw cycles and exceptional accuracy, making them a top choice for serious bowhunters.
  • Hoyt: Established in 1931, Hoyt is a well-respected name in the archery community, producing high-quality bows in Salt Lake City, Utah. Their compound bows are known for their durability and performance, featuring advanced technology such as the patented Cam and a Half system, providing excellent energy efficiency and speed.
  • PSE (Precision Shooting Equipment): Founded in 1970, PSE manufactures its bows in Tucson, Arizona, and is recognized for its wide range of performance-driven models. PSE bows focus on delivering speed and power, often incorporating cutting-edge technology that appeals to competitive archers and hunters alike.
  • Bear Archery: With a legacy dating back to 1933, Bear Archery produces its bows in Gainesville, Florida, and is known for combining traditional craftsmanship with modern technology. Their compound bows are praised for their ergonomic designs and user-friendly setups, making them ideal for novices and experienced archers.
  • Elite Archery: Based in the U.S., Elite Archery is known for its commitment to quality and performance, with manufacturing facilities located in the heart of the Midwest. Their bows are designed with a focus on tunability and customization, providing archers with a tailored shooting experience that enhances accuracy and comfort.
